Artistic Soup Photography had the privilege of photographing Kelly’s Bridal Shower this past Sunday, March 14th, 2010.
Sarah created an amazing tropically themed Bridal Shower for her sister Kelly including a cabanna hut, seashells, palm tree cupcakes and Hawaiian skirts. The party was clearly cherished by all family and friends invited as they laughed, ate well and played bridal shower games for over two hours.
However, there was one family member near and dear to their hearts that was not present. Grandmother, Sue Tolley, who was diagnosed at age 50 with cancer, went into remission after treatment, but died 7 years ago when the cancer came back. In addition to honoring her this day they also chose to use this celebration to raise money for cancer research. Sarah chose artist, Stacey Valle of St. Louis to create a unique bracelet to raise funds for the cause.
The bracelets include four wooden discs with stamped lettering then hand-painted and sprayed with several coats of gloss acrylic varnish. Discs are linked with jump rings and chain with toggle clasp. One side of bracelet says CURE and other side says HOPE. Length of bracelet is 8″. Chain links could be removed or added to adjust length. They come in many color combinations of light and dark pink, white and brown.
